Darapur Village - Pataudi, Gurugram
Darapur is a village situated in the Pataudi tehsil of Gurugram district, Haryana. It is located approximately 7 km from Pataudi and around 38 km from Gurgaon. Darapur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Darapur is 062788. The village covers a total geographical area of 164 hectares and falls under the 122414 pincode. Pataudi is the nearest town.
Darapur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Pataudi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Gurgaon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Darapur
As per Census 2011, Darapur village has a total population of 1,203 people, consisting of 635 males and 568 females. The village has 236 households and a sex ratio of 894 females per 1,000 males. There are 120 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 923 literate and 280 illiterate residents. Additionally, 257 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Darapur are given below:
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,203 | 635 | 568 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 120 | 73 | 47 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 257 | 130 | 127 |
| Literate Population | 923 | 522 | 401 |
| Illiterate Population | 280 | 113 | 167 |

Transport and Connectivity of Darapur
Darapur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Inchhapuri, while the nearest airport is Indira Gandhi International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 38.9 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Gurgaon to Darapur is about 38 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
